I have pain in my middle finger joint, when I press it even if mildly. Can it be arthritis?

Actually there can be many reasons for an isolated finger pain, there definitely can be arthritis of the affected finger especially if there is a pre existing h/o an injury to the affected finger, there can be tendinitis, ganglion etc. If there is no associated swelling, skin redness or local warmth etc, then you can start with conservative management in form of gentle anti inflammatory medication, physical therapy, local analgesic spray etc and we see the response for next 3-4 weeks. If it does not settle down, then we will get the x ray (hand ap & oblique) view and a few blood tests for evaluation. Do not hesitate to contact me if you need any further assistance.
